Output 59b3d226632378f311e0bfa4b0821f683c9b28b7413ac846c72e0a1716143faa:0

value
2339114
script pubkey
OP_0 OP_PUSHBYTES_20 7bba2be045da0b35ce8a422effe14774247816cb
address
bc1q0wazhcz9mg9ntn52ggh0lc28wsj8s9kthgqhwq
transaction
59b3d226632378f311e0bfa4b0821f683c9b28b7413ac846c72e0a1716143faa
spent
true